 +===== Known Problems =====
 +
 +==== Help! I cannot change CPU frequency nor governor in the CPU information dialog ====
 +This is not a bug, though it might look like one because of the widgets used that pretentiously suggest the user could change something. Changing CPU frequency or the governor is not implemented and probably will never be, as it is supposed to be handled by the kernel or power manager. The only function this plugin nowadays performs is showing CPU frequency information. The CPU info dialog is a remnant of the past when it was still possible to change these settings (or at least when it was planned to implement this). It will be redesigned to use proper widgets in a future version. More information about this can be read in [[https://bugzilla.xfce.org/show_bug.cgi?id=3428|bug #3428]].

 +==== 1.1.2 (2015-06-23) ====
 +  * Fix IT_PROG_INTLTOOL warning
 +  * Translation updates: Basque, Bulgarian, Greek, Lithuanian, Slovak, Spanish, Swedish
 +
 +==== 1.1.1 (2014-12-23) ====
 +  * Fix panel resizing caused by freq format function (bug #10385)
 +  * Various other widget layout fixes and simplifications
 +  * Fix missing return type of cpufreq_show_about (bug #10343)
 +  * Fix typo in panel-plugin/Makefile.am (bug #10332)
 +  * Various other fixes to the build system
 +  * Many translation updates
 +
 +==== 1.1.0 (2013-09-03) ====
 +  * Support the Intel performance state driver
 +  * Improve config dialog and make it use shortcut keys
 +  * Add a proper "About" dialog
 +  * Add min, avg and max frequencies in cpu selection
 +  * Add support for selecting a custom font
 +  * Support showing icon only (bug #7474)
 +  * Improve overview window size and layout
 +  * Remove code for showing the frame
 +  * Rewrite layout code using >=xfce4-panel-4.9 features
 +  * Remove code for deprecated APIs and <xfce4-panel-4.9
 +  * Build plugin as a module
 +  * Fix showing frequency of wrong CPU core (bug #7179)
 +  * Fix reading min frequency from cpufreq sysfs
 +  * Support panel 4.9 features (deskbar mode) (bug #8396)
 +  * Port plugin to libxfce4ui (bug #8051)
 +  * Code clean up and refactoring
 +  * Updates and fixes for build system files
